Get to know MDN better
Dieser Inhalt wurde automatisch aus dem Englischen übersetzt, und kann Fehler enthalten. Erfahre mehr über dieses Experiment.
Diese Funktion ist gut etabliert und funktioniert auf vielen Geräten und in vielen Browserversionen. Sie ist seit Januar 2020 browserübergreifend verfügbar.
Hinweis: Diese Funktion ist in Web Workers verfügbar.
Die TextDecoder-Schnittstelle repräsentiert einen Decoder für eine spezifische Textkodierung, wie z.B. UTF-8, ISO-8859-2 oder GBK. Ein Decoder nimmt ein Byte-Array als Eingabe und gibt einen JavaScript-String zurück.
Erstellt und gibt einen neuen TextDecoder zurück.
Die TextDecoder-Schnittstelle erbt keine Eigenschaften.
TextDecoder.encoding SchreibgeschütztEin String, der den Namen des Zeichencodierungssystems enthält, das dieser TextDecoder verwenden wird.
TextDecoder.fatal SchreibgeschütztEin boolescher Wert, der angibt, ob der Fehlermodus fatal ist.
TextDecoder.ignoreBOM SchreibgeschütztEin boolescher Wert, der angibt, ob die Byte-Order-Markierung ignoriert wird.
Die TextDecoder-Schnittstelle erbt keine Methoden.
TextDecoder.decode()Dekodiert die gegebenen Bytes in einen JavaScript-String und gibt ihn zurück.
Dieses Beispiel zeigt, wie die UTF-8-Kodierung des Zeichens "𠮷" dekodiert wird.
In diesem Beispiel dekodieren wir den russischen Text "Привет, мир!", was "Hallo, Welt." bedeutet. In unserem TextDecoder()-Konstruktor spezifizieren wir die Windows-1251-Zeichencodierung.
| Encoding # interface-textdecoder |
JavaScript aktivieren, um diese Browser-Kompatibilitätstabelle anzuzeigen.
Der Bauplan für ein besseres Internet.
Besuche die gemeinnützige Muttergesellschaft der Mozilla Corporation, die Mozilla Foundation.
Teile dieses Inhalts sind ©1998–2026 von einzelnen mozilla.org-Mitwirkenden. Inhalte sind verfügbar unter einer Creative-Commons-Lizenz.